A Cycle Of Coffee Pleasure

True coffee pleasure should leave an impact on our senses, not the planet. We carefully select our packaging and materials to protect the precious flavours and aromas of our coffee whilst being respectful of the environment. We are working towards reaching 100% recyclable packaging by 2030. Using the infinite recyclability of aluminum capsules, alongside reusable glass jars and paper bags. Reducing our impact in present, to protect a more sustainable future, in which coffee pleasure can last.

Preserving Coffee Diversity​

The beauty of nature inspires us in our creations, and we are continually looking to blend the most intriguing coffees sourced from different regions. By partnering with World Coffee Research, L’OR supports the research, and enrichment of a diverse variety of coffees across the globe. From supporting farmers to choosing the most fruitful varieties. We do this because we know that a world without coffee diversity is a world without coffee pleasure.
